Enter sister designer duo Ashley and Kimberly Ulmer and their fabulous new bag business - Green Eyed Monster. These gals have taken the mundane (and somewhat humble) reusable bag and turned it into an artistic environmental statement.

Their popular bags are a bit larger than the standard cloth bag (15" X 18" X 4"), made with 100% recycled cotton and plastic bottles but best of all, each bag is a limited edition work of art.

The savvy sisters have activated the art community to submit their eco-artwork in various bag design competitions. The winners get a juicy cash prize and their artwork is featured on a limited print run of the latest Green Eyed Monster bag. Only 1,000 bags are printed for each design.
